Abstract
Introduction Hyperemesis gravidarum (HG) is a serious complication of pregnancy involving nausea and vomiting which affects all facets of the lives of many women. Helicobacter pylori infection has been linked to HG in some regions of the world. However, the prevalence of H. pylori in Saudi Arabian pregnant women and its link to HG has not been the subject of previous research. Detecting and treating H. pylori infection in women early in their pregnancies may lower the likelihood of adverse maternal outcomes. This study aims to assess the connection between the pathogenesis of HG and H. pylori infection in this population. Methods Forty-five pregnant women with HG were recruited from the outpatient clinic for antenatal care in the Gynecology and Obstetrics Department at King Abdulaziz University Hospital. Forty-five pregnant women without HG were matched as controls. Both groups underwent testing for the H. pylori antigen in stool samples. Results A statistically significant difference (P < 0.05) was observed between the cases and controls in terms of the occurrence of H. pylori. Thirty-eight women in the HG group (84.4%) tested positive for H. pylori, while the same was true of only 20 of the controls (44.4%). The mean level of blood hemoglobin in positive cases was significantly lower than that in negative cases (9.56 ± 1.29 vs. 11.90 ± 1.18 g/dl, P = 0.012). Conclusion H. pylori may play a contributing role in the presence of HG in the study population. It may be included with other investigations of HG, especially with cases that do not respond to conventional management and continue into the second trimester. Women with H. pylori were also more likely to suffer from anemia compared to those without the infection. For this reason, those working with pregnant women should pay close attention to those infected with H. pylori. Additional large case–control studies are necessary to better understand the part H. pylori plays and the pathogenesis of HG.

Abstract
Introduction A potential protective role of Helicobacter pylori (HP) infection against the development of Crohn's disease (CD) has been postulated. There is a lack of studies evaluating the association of HP with CD phenotypes. The aim of this study was to investigate the clinical features and disease activity of patients with CD who were diagnosed with HP infection. Methods The charts of 306 consecutive patients from the inflammatory bowel disease (IBD) database at the University of Florida College of Medicine, Jacksonville from January 2014 to July 2016 were reviewed. Ninety-one CD patients who were tested for HP were included, and the frequencies of strictures, fistulas, and colitis in surveillance biopsies in these patients were evaluated. Results Of the 91 CD patients tested for HP, 19 had HP infection. A total of 44 patients had fistulizing/stricturing disease, and 62 patients had active colitis. In the univariate analysis, patients with HP infection had less fistulizing/stricturing disease (21.1% vs. 55.6%, p = 0.009) and less active colitis (42.1% vs. 77.1%, p = 0.005). In the multivariate analysis, HP infection remained as a protective factor for fistulizing/stricturing disease phenotype (OR: 0.22; 95%CI: 0.06-0.97; p = 0.022) and active colitis (OR: 0.186; 95%CI: 0.05-0.65; p = 0.010). Conclusion HP infection was independently associated with less fistulizing/stricturing disease and less active colitis in CD patients. Our study suggests CD patients with a history of HP infection are less prone to complications.

Abstract
BACKGROUND Helicobacter pylori (H pylori) infection has been implicated in a number of malignancies and non-malignant conditions including peptic ulcers, non-ulcer dyspepsia, recurrent peptic ulcer bleeding, unexplained iron deficiency anaemia, idiopathic thrombocytopaenia purpura, and colorectal adenomas. The confirmatory diagnosis of H pylori is by endoscopic biopsy, followed by histopathological examination using haemotoxylin and eosin (H & E) stain or special stains such as Giemsa stain and Warthin-Starry stain. Special stains are more accurate than H & E stain. There is significant uncertainty about the diagnostic accuracy of non-invasive tests for diagnosis of H pylori. OBJECTIVES To compare the diagnostic accuracy of urea breath test, serology, and stool antigen test, used alone or in combination, for diagnosis of H pylori infection in symptomatic and asymptomatic people, so that eradication therapy for H pylori can be started. SEARCH METHODS We searched MEDLINE, Embase, the Science Citation Index and the National Institute for Health Research Health Technology Assessment Database on 4 March 2016. We screened references in the included studies to identify additional studies. We also conducted citation searches of relevant studies, most recently on 4 December 2016. We did not restrict studies by language or publication status, or whether data were collected prospectively or retrospectively. SELECTION CRITERIA We included diagnostic accuracy studies that evaluated at least one of the index tests (urea breath test using isotopes such as 13C or 14C, serology and stool antigen test) against the reference standard (histopathological examination using H & E stain, special stains or immunohistochemical stain) in people suspected of having H pylori infection. DATA COLLECTION AND ANALYSIS Two review authors independently screened the references to identify relevant studies and independently extracted data. We assessed the methodological quality of studies using the QUADAS-2 tool. We performed meta-analysis by using the hierarchical summary receiver operating characteristic (HSROC) model to estimate and compare SROC curves. Where appropriate, we used bivariate or univariate logistic regression models to estimate summary sensitivities and specificities. MAIN RESULTS We included 101 studies involving 11,003 participants, of which 5839 participants (53.1%) had H pylori infection. The prevalence of H pylori infection in the studies ranged from 15.2% to 94.7%, with a median prevalence of 53.7% (interquartile range 42.0% to 66.5%). Most of the studies (57%) included participants with dyspepsia and 53 studies excluded participants who recently had proton pump inhibitors or antibiotics.There was at least an unclear risk of bias or unclear applicability concern for each study.Of the 101 studies, 15 compared the accuracy of two index tests and two studies compared the accuracy of three index tests. Thirty-four studies (4242 participants) evaluated serology; 29 studies (2988 participants) evaluated stool antigen test; 34 studies (3139 participants) evaluated urea breath test-13C; 21 studies (1810 participants) evaluated urea breath test-14C; and two studies (127 participants) evaluated urea breath test but did not report the isotope used. The thresholds used to define test positivity and the staining techniques used for histopathological examination (reference standard) varied between studies. Due to sparse data for each threshold reported, it was not possible to identify the best threshold for each test.Using data from 99 studies in an indirect test comparison, there was statistical evidence of a difference in diagnostic accuracy between urea breath test-13C, urea breath test-14C, serology and stool antigen test (P = 0.024). The diagnostic odds ratios for urea breath test-13C, urea breath test-14C, serology, and stool antigen test were 153 (95% confidence interval (CI) 73.7 to 316), 105 (95% CI 74.0 to 150), 47.4 (95% CI 25.5 to 88.1) and 45.1 (95% CI 24.2 to 84.1). The sensitivity (95% CI) estimated at a fixed specificity of 0.90 (median from studies across the four tests), was 0.94 (95% CI 0.89 to 0.97) for urea breath test-13C, 0.92 (95% CI 0.89 to 0.94) for urea breath test-14C, 0.84 (95% CI 0.74 to 0.91) for serology, and 0.83 (95% CI 0.73 to 0.90) for stool antigen test. This implies that on average, given a specificity of 0.90 and prevalence of 53.7% (median specificity and prevalence in the studies), out of 1000 people tested for H pylori infection, there will be 46 false positives (people without H pylori infection who will be diagnosed as having H pylori infection). In this hypothetical cohort, urea breath test-13C, urea breath test-14C, serology, and stool antigen test will give 30 (95% CI 15 to 58), 42 (95% CI 30 to 58), 86 (95% CI 50 to 140), and 89 (95% CI 52 to 146) false negatives respectively (people with H pylori infection for whom the diagnosis of H pylori will be missed).Direct comparisons were based on few head-to-head studies. The ratios of diagnostic odds ratios (DORs) were 0.68 (95% CI 0.12 to 3.70; P = 0.56) for urea breath test-13C versus serology (seven studies), and 0.88 (95% CI 0.14 to 5.56; P = 0.84) for urea breath test-13C versus stool antigen test (seven studies). The 95% CIs of these estimates overlap with those of the ratios of DORs from the indirect comparison. Data were limited or unavailable for meta-analysis of other direct comparisons. AUTHORS' CONCLUSIONS In people without a history of gastrectomy and those who have not recently had antibiotics or proton ,pump inhibitors, urea breath tests had high diagnostic accuracy while serology and stool antigen tests were less accurate for diagnosis of Helicobacter pylori infection.This is based on an indirect test comparison (with potential for bias due to confounding), as evidence from direct comparisons was limited or unavailable. The thresholds used for these tests were highly variable and we were unable to identify specific thresholds that might be useful in clinical practice.We need further comparative studies of high methodological quality to obtain more reliable evidence of relative accuracy between the tests. Such studies should be conducted prospectively in a representative spectrum of participants and clearly reported to ensure low risk of bias. Most importantly, studies should prespecify and clearly report thresholds used, and should avoid inappropriate exclusions.

Abstract
BACKGROUND Hyperemesis gravidarum remains a common, distressing, and significant yet poorly understood disorder during pregnancy. The association between maternal Helicobacter pylori (H. pylori) infection and hyperemesis gravidarum has been increasingly recognized and investigated. This study thus aimed to provide an updated review and meta-analysis of the topic. METHODS Using the search terms (H. pyloriOR Helicobacter ORHelicobacter pyloriOR infection) AND (pregnancy OR emesis OR hyperemesis gravidarum OR nausea OR vomiting), a preliminary search on the PubMed, Ovid, Web of Science, Google Scholar, and WanFang database yielded 372 papers published in English between January 1st, 1960 and June 1st, 2017. RESULTS A total of 38 cross-sectional and case-control studies, with a total of 10 289 patients were eligible for review. Meta-analysis revealed a significant association between H. pylori infection and hyperemesis gravidarum during pregnancy, with a pooled odds ratio of 1.348 (95% CI: 1.156-1.539, P < .001). Subgroup analysis found that serologic and stool antigen tests were comparable methods of detecting H. pylori as they yielded similar odds ratios. LIMITATIONS Although the studies did not have high heterogeneity (I2 = 28%), publication bias was observed, and interstudy discrepancies in the diagnostic criteria adopted for hyperemesis gravidarum limit the reliability of findings. Also, 15 of the included studies were from the same country (Turkey), which could limit the generalizability of current findings. The prevalence of H. pylori infection varies throughout the world, and there may also be pathogenic differences as most strains of H. pylori in East Asia carry the cytotoxin-associated gene A gene. CONCLUSION H. pylori infection was associated with an increased likelihood of hyperemesis gravidarum during pregnancy. Given the high prevalence of H. pylori infections worldwide, detecting H. pylori infection and the eradication of maternal H. pylori infection could be part of maternal hyperemesis gravidarum management. Further confirmation with robust longitudinal studies and mechanistic investigations are needed.

Abstract
BACKGROUND Helicobacter pylori infection is etiologically associated with some important health problems such as gastric cancer. Because of the high clinical importance of H. pylori infection, development of a noninvasive test for the detection of H. pylori is desirable. METHODS In this study, a loop-mediated isothermal amplification (LAMP) targeted ureC of H. pylori was evaluated on 100 stool specimens and compared with a stool antigen test. Culture and rapid urease test were considered as gold standards. RESULTS The overall detection rate of the fecal antigen test and LAMP was 58% and 82%, respectively. The analytical sensitivity of the fecal antigen test and LAMP was 500 and 10 H. pylori cells/g and 10 fg DNA/reaction, which is equal to six H. pylori genome. CONCLUSION LAMP technique has been characterized by high sensitivity and low detection limit for the detection of H. pylori in stool specimen. Clinical diagnostic performance of LAMP was better than the stool antigen test.

Abstract
Background. Several studies have shown a possible involvement of Helicobacter pylori (H. pylori) infection in individuals with hyperemesis gravidarum (HG), but the relationship remains controversial. This meta-analysis was performed to validate and strengthen the association between HG and H. pylori infection. Methods. PubMed, Embase, and Web of Science databases up to March 20, 2014, were searched to select studies on the prevalence of H. pylori infection between pregnant women with HG and the normal pregnant control subjects. Results. Of the HG cases, 1289 (69.6%) were H. pylori-positive; however, 1045 (46.2%) were H. pylori-positive in control group. Compared to the non-HG normal pregnant controls, infection rate of H. pylori was significantly higher in pregnant women with HG (OR = 3.34, 95% CI: 2.32–4.81, P < 0.001). Subgroup analysis indicated that H. pylori infection was a risk factor of HG in Asia, Africa, and Oceania, especially in Africa (OR = 12.38, 95% CI: 7.12–21.54, P < 0.001). Conclusions. H. pylori should be considered one of the risk factors of HG, especially in the developing countries. H. pylori eradication could be considered to relieve the symptoms of HG in some intractable cases.

Abstract
With 50-90% of pregnant women experiencing nausea and vomiting of pregnancy (NVP), the burden of illness can become quite significant if symptoms are under-treated and/or under-diagnosed, thus allowing for progression of the disease. The majority of these women will necessitate at least one visit with a provider to specifically address NVP, and up to 10% or greater will require pharmacotherapy after failure of conservative measures to adequately control symptoms. As a result, initiation of prompt and effective treatment in the outpatient setting is ideal. Once NVP is diagnosed and treatment is started, it is crucial to track symptoms in order to assess for a decrease in or resolution of symptoms as well as an escalation in symptoms requiring additional therapy. Of note, co-existing gastroesophageal reflux disease (GERD), Helicobacter pylori infection, and psychosocial factors may have a negative impact on the management of NVP. Ultimately, every woman has her own perception of disease severity and desire for treatment. It is critical that both the provider and patient be proactive in the diagnosis and management of NVP.

Abstract
Helicobacter pylori (H. pylori) is an extremely common, yet underappreciated, pathogen that is able to alter host physiology and subvert the host immune response, allowing it to persist for the life of the host. H. pylori is the primary cause of peptic ulcers and gastric cancer. In the United States, the annual cost associated with peptic ulcer disease is estimated to be $6 billion and gastric cancer kills over 700000 people per year globally. The prevalence of H. pylori infection remains high (> 50%) in much of the world, although the infection rates are dropping in some developed nations. The drop in H. pylori prevalence could be a double-edged sword, reducing the incidence of gastric diseases while increasing the risk of allergies and esophageal diseases. The list of diseases potentially caused by H. pylori continues to grow; however, mechanistic explanations of how H. pylori could contribute to extragastric diseases lag far behind clinical studies. A number of host factors and H. pylori virulence factors act in concert to determine which individuals are at the highest risk of disease. These include bacterial cytotoxins and polymorphisms in host genes responsible for directing the immune response. This review discusses the latest advances in H. pylori pathogenesis, diagnosis, and treatment. Up-to-date information on correlations between H. pylori and extragastric diseases is also provided.

Abstract
OBJECTIVE Currently, there is no consensus on the definition of hyperemesis gravidarum (HG; protracted vomiting in pregnancy) and no single widely used set of diagnostic criteria for HG. The various definitions rely on symptoms, sometimes in combination with laboratory tests. Through a systematic review, we aimed to summarize available evidence on the diagnostic value of biomarkers for HG. This could assist diagnosis and may shed light on the, as yet, not understood cause of the disorder. STUDY DESIGN We searched Medline and Embase for articles about diagnostic biomarkers for either the presence or severity of HG or nausea and vomiting of pregnancy. We defined HG as any combination of nausea, vomiting, dehydration, weight loss, or hospitalization for nausea and/or vomiting in pregnancy, in the absence of any other obvious cause for these complaints. RESULTS We found 81 articles on 9 biomarkers. Although 65% of all studies included only HG cases with ketonuria, we did not find an association between ketonuria and presence or severity of HG in 5 studies reporting on this association. Metaanalysis, with the use of the hierarchical summary receiver operating characteristics model, yielded an odds ratio of 3.2 (95% confidence interval, 2.0-5.1) of Heliobacter pylori for HG, as compared with asymptomatic control subjects (sensitivity, 73%; specificity, 55%). Studies on human chorionic gonadotropin and thyroid hormones, leptin, estradiol, progesterone, and white blood count showed inconsistent associations with HG; lymphocytes tended to be higher in women with HG. CONCLUSION We did not find support for the use of ketonuria in the diagnosis of HG. H pylori serology might be useful in specific patients.

Abstract
Objective: the aim of this research was to determine the prevalence of Helicobacter pylori infection on Chilean pregnant women and its relationship with the appearance and severity of hyperemesis and dyspepsia. Methods: quantitative study of prevalence in a transversal cut with variable analysis. The sample was taken from 274 Chilean pregnant women from the Bío Bío province through vein puncture between June and December, 2005. Pregnant women were informed of this study, interviewed and signed an informed consent. The samples were processed using ImmunoComb II Helicobacter pylori IgG kit. Statistical analysis was performed by means of the Statistical Package for Social Sciences (SPSS) Program. Results: out of the total number of pregnant women, 68.6% showed infection by Helicobacter pylori. 79.6% of the total sample had symptoms of dyspepsia, and 72.5% of this group presented Helicobacter pylori infection. 12.4% showed pregnancy hyperemesis; among them, 79.4% were infected with Helicobacter pylori. 73.4% of the pregnant women that showed gastric discomfort during the first three months had Helicobacter pylori infection. 53.7% of them continued with gastric discomfort after the first three months; of those, 95.8% were infected. Helicobacter pylori infection was present only in 1.5% of pregnant women without gastric discomfort. Conclusion: both, gastric discomfort of pregnant women and the continuity of severe symptoms of dyspepsia and hyperemesis after the first three months of gestation are significantly correlated with Helicobacter pylori infection.

Abstract
Helicobacter pylori (H. pylori) infection is investigated in gastric diseases even during pregnancy. In particular, this Gram-negative bacterium seems to be associated with hyperemesis gravidarum, a severe form of nausea and vomiting during pregnancy. During the last decade, the relationship among H. pylori and several extra-gastric diseases strongly emerged in literature. The correlation among H. pylori infection and pregnancy-related disorders was mainly focused on iron deficiency anemia, thrombocytopenia, fetal malformations, miscarriage, pre-eclampsia and fetal growth restriction. H. pylori infection may have a role in the pathogenesis of various pregnancy-related disorders through different mechanisms: depletion of micronutrients (iron and vitamin B12) in maternal anemia and fetal neural tube defects; local or systemic induction of pro-inflammatory cytokines release and oxidative stress in gastrointestinal disorders and pre-eclampsia; cross-reaction between specific anti-H. pylori antibodies and antigens localized in placental tissue and endothelial cells (pre-eclampsia, fetal growth restriction, miscarriage). Since H. pylori infection is most likely acquired before pregnancy, it is widely believed that hormonal and immunological changes occurring during pregnancy could activate latent H. pylori with a negative impact not only on maternal health (nutritional deficiency, organ injury, death), but also on the fetus (insufficient growth, malformation, death) and sometime consequences can be observed later in life. Another important issue addressed by investigators was to determine whether it is possible to transmit H. pylori infection from mother to child and whether maternal anti-H. pylori antibodies could prevent infant’s infection. Studies on novel diagnostic and therapeutic methods for H. pylori are no less important, since these are particularly sensitive topics in pregnancy conditions. It could be interesting to study the possible correlation between H. pylori infection and other pregnancy-related diseases of unknown etiology, such as gestational diabetes mellitus, obstetric cholestasis and spontaneous preterm delivery. Since H. pylori infection is treatable, the demonstration of its causative role in pregnancy-related disorders will have important social-economic implications.

Abstract
Objective: Helicobacter Pylori (H.pylori) is one of the most important causes of dyspepsia and diagnosis can be made by invasive or non-invasive methods. One of the non-invasive methods, H.pylori stool antigen test (HpSA) is simple, fast and relatively inexpensive. According to this view with regard to gastric biopsy as a gold standard the sensitivity, specificity, positive and negative predictive values of this method were calculated. Methodology: Stool samples of 61 patients who underwent upper endoscopy and gastric biopsy due to dyspepsia were evaluated for H. Pylori stool antigen using sandwich ELISA method. Results: From the 61 patients who participated in this study, H.pylori was diagnosed in 38 (62.3%) gastric biopsies, 25(66%) of these had positive HpSA test. Also, of 27 (37.7%) positive HpSA cases, H.pylori was seen in 25 gastric biopsies. For this method, sensitivity of 66% with 93% positive predictive value was calculated. Also, 91% specificity with 62% negative predictive value was estimated. Conclusion: High positive HpSA indicates high risk of H.pylori infection and high specificity shows that the likelihood of false positive is low. Therefore, physicians can trust on this method and start patient`s treatment.

Abstract
NVP occurs in 50–90% of pregnancies, making it a common medical condition in pregnancy. Women present differently with any combination of signs and symptoms. It is appropriate to take the pregnancy-related versus nonpregnancy-related approach when determining the cause of nausea and vomiting but other causes should be considered. The most common etiologies for NVP include the hormonal changes associated with pregnancy, the physiologic changes in the gastrointestinal tract, and a genetic predisposition. Up to 10% of women will require pharmacotherapy to treat the symptoms of NVP despite conservative measures. ACOG currently recommends that a combination of oral pyridoxine hydrochloride and doxylamine succinate be used as first-line treatment for NVP if pyridoxine monotherapy does not relieve symptoms. A review of NVP and early pharmacotherapeutic management is presented due to the fact that NVP is largely undertreated, and investigations into the safe and effective pharmacotherapies available to treat NVP are lacking.
